(Phoenix, AZ) — The Cardinals scored three unanswered runs after falling behind 1-0 to grab a 3-1 win over the Diamondbacks at Chase Field. Mark Reynolds tied the game at one in the fifth with a solo blast against his former team and Kolten Wong’s RBI double put St.Louis ahead for good. Matt Carpenter added an insurance tally on an RBI single. John Lackey improved to 11-and-8 with seven innings of one-run ball and Trevor Rosenthal locked up his 40th save.
>>Cardinals Face Snakes One More Time
(Phoenix, AZ) — The Cardinals and Diamondbacks meet one more time tonight in the desert. It’s the finale of their four-game series at Chase Field, with Carlos Martinez slated to oppose Arizona’s Rubby De La Rosa. The Redbirds have won the first three games in the set. After tonight, the Cards head to San Francisco to take on the Giants tomorrow night.
>>Giants Cool Off Cubs
(San Francisco, CA) — Buster Posey doubled in a run and scored another in the sixth as the Giants cooled off the Cubs with a 4-2 win. Kris Bryant doubled home a pair in the first for Chicago, which had won six in-a-row and lost for only the fifth time in its last 26 games. Kyle Hendricks allowed all four runs in six frames to fall to 6-and-6. The teams wrap up the three-game series this afternoon.
